Asset-based appraisal offers a basic methodology for calculating the price of a business . This method focuses on the total asset base , transactional which represents the difference between a firm's aggregate assets and its complete liabilities. Essentially, it’s a examination at what a firm would be valued if its assets were sold at their fair value and all debts were paid . While simpler to perform than some other appraisal methods, it's often most suitable for companies with substantial real assets or in situations involving liquidation .

Asset Appraisal in Lending – A Detailed Breakdown
When issuing loans , lenders must have a complete understanding of the price of the properties being used as guarantee . This assessment can be performed through various approaches . Common processes include the outlay approach, which calculates the rebuild cost less depreciation ; the comparative approach, which examines recent transactions of similar assets ; and the revenue approach, which forecasts future returns based on the property’s ability to generate income . Furthermore, lenders often utilize professional assessors and consider third-party assessments to confirm an precise judgment of asset worth and lessen exposure .
Book Value Analysis
The net asset approach is a strategy for determining the value of a organization by concentrating on the difference between its resources and its obligations. Essentially , it entails a thorough review of the entity's financial statements to record the fair market value of each tangible asset, such as land, machinery , and goods, less any existing liabilities like loans and bills . Core principles include net asset value , which represents the amount that would be distributed to stakeholders if the firm were liquidated and its property marketed at their recorded values.
